Applications and Advantages of NMP in the Coating and Ink Industry

  In the production of modern high-performance coatings and inks, NMP (N-Methyl-2-pyrrolidone , cas : 872-50-4 )  plays an irreplaceable role as an efficient solvent. With its excellent solvency, good chemical stability, and moderate evaporation rate, NMP is widely used in demanding coating and ink systems. This article provides a detailed overview of the main applications, benefits, and future trends of NMP in this industry. 1. Basic Characteristics of NMP NMP is a highly polar, high-boiling (202°C), low-volatility organic solvent with excellent solvency. It can dissolve a wide range of natural and synthetic polymers such as polyurethane, epoxy resin, and acrylic resin. Its transparency and low odor also make it suitable for indoor applications. 2. Applications in Coatings In the coatings industry, NMP is primarily used as a solvent for base materials like polyurethane and epoxy resins. Applications of NMP in the Semiconductor and Electronics Industry

  I. Introduction N-Methyl-Pyrrolidone (NMP)   is a product with a wide range of applications. In the previous issue, we discussed its use in the lithium battery industry. This issue will focus on its applications in the semiconductor and electronics industry. II. Main Applications of NMP in the Semiconductor and Electronics Industry 1. Wafer Cleaning with NMP During semiconductor manufacturing, organic contaminants and fine dust easily adhere to the wafer surface. Due to its excellent solubility, NMP can effectively remove grease, flux residues, and metal ions from the wafer surface, ensuring cleanliness and improving chip yield. 2. Photoresist Stripping Photoresist is a key material in semiconductor manufacturing, but after exposure and etching, the remaining photoresist must be completely removed.
